Set within the stunning landscape of the Fountains Abbey and Studley Royal World Heritage Site, St Mary's Church, commissioned by the Marquess and Marchioness of Ripon, is a masterpiece of the Victorian Gothic Revival style. Designed by renowned architect William Burges and built between 1871 and 1878, the exterior is dominated by an impressive steeple. It is the richly decorated interior, however, that is worthy of particular note. Bathed in light from the magnificent stained-glass windows, this outstanding Grade I listed church is lavishly adorned with fine marble, gilding, murals and mosaics.
